HomeMy WebLinkAboutOrdinance No. 2026-06 Amending Arts in Aventura Board - April 7, 2026CITY OF AVENTURA ORDINANCE NO. 2026-06
A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Y OF AVENTURA, FLORIDA AMENDING
ARTICLE III "ADVISORY BOARDS" OF CHAPTER 2
"ADMINISTRATION" OF THE CITY CODE BY AMENDING SECTION 2-
191 "CREATION AND COMPOSITION" BY AUTHORIZING THE CITY
MANAGER TO INCREASE THE SIZE OF THE BOARD WHEN
NECESSARY AND REMOVING THE RESIDENCY REQUIREMENT FOR
BOARD MEMBERS; PROVIDING FOR SEVERABILITY; PROVIDING
FOR INCLUSION IN THE CODE; AND PROVIDING FOR AN EFFECTIVE
DATE.
WHEREAS, the City Commission of the City of Aventura, Florida (the "City") finds
it periodically necessary to amend its Code of Ordinances (the "City Code") in order to
update regulations and procedures to implement municipal goals and objectives; and
WHEREAS, the City Commission desires to amend Chapter 2 "Administration,"
Article III "Advisory Boards" by amending Section 2-191 to provide for greater flexibility
with concerning the appointment of board members to the newly -created Arts in Aventura
Board; and
WHEREAS, the City Commission has held the required public hearings, duly
noticed in accordance with the law; and
WHEREAS, the City Commission has reviewed the action set forth in this
Ordinance and has determined that such action is consistent with the City Code of
Ordinances.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E CITY COMMISSION OF THE
CITY OF AVENTURA, FLORIDA, THAT:
Section 1. Recitals Adopted. Each of the above stated recitals is hereby
adopted and confirmed.
Section 2. City Code Amended. Chapter 2 "Administration," Article III
"Advisory Boards" of the City Code of Ordinances is hereby amended as follows:'

Division 5. - Arts in Aventura Board
Sec. 2-121. - Creation and Composition.
(a) There is hereby created and established the Arts in Aventura Advisory Board (the
"Board") consisting of five (5) members no more than seven (7) members, who shall
be appointed by the Mayor, subject to the approval of the City Commission.
Members will be appointed for a term of two years and may serve multiple terms.

;,TtMeRt. Preference will be given to City residents, though residency is not a
prerequisite to appointment as the City desires to appoint individuals to serve on the
Board who possess the necessary skills, knowledge and ability regardless of
residency.
Section 3. Severability. The provisions of this Ordinance are declared to be
severable and if any section, sentence, clause or phrase of this Ordinance shall for any
reason be held to be invalid or unconstitutional, such decision shall not affect the validity
of the remaining sections, sentences, clauses, and phrases of this Ordinance but they
shall remain in effect, it being the legislative intent that this Ordinance shall stand
notwithstanding the invalidity of any part.
Section 4. Inclusion in the Code. It is the intention of the City Commission,
and it is hereby ordained that the provisions of this Ordinance shall become and be made
a part of the Code of the City of Aventura; that the sections of this Ordinance may be
renumbered or re -lettered to accomplish such intentions; and that the word "Ordinance"
shall be changed to "Section" or other appropriate word.
Section 5. Effective Date. This Ordinance shall be effective immediately upon
adoption on second reading.
